Mathura/Lucknow: As many as 21 people including two police officers have been killed in the Jawaharbagh violence which took place following removal of encroachment on Thursday under city kotwali area.

Principal Secretary, Home Debashish Panda and Uttar Pradesh Director General of Police (DGP) Javeed Ahmad, have reached the spot on instructions of Chief Minister Akhilesh Yadav to take stock of the situation , sources said.

Around 400 people have been taken into custody and the situation is under control but tensed, they added.

Pradeep Bhatnagar, Agra Divisional Commissioner is probing the case.

What is the matter?

  • Operation Jawaharbagh began to vacate sprawling acres of land from the activists of Baba Jai Gurudev.
  • Activists had reportedly occupied the land on the pretext of ‘dharna’ for over two years.
  • Activists retaliated to police action with gunshots resulting into violent clash.

Meanwhile, the residents of Mathura and kins of slain police officer Mukul Dwivedi are protesting against the incident and are demanding that Chief Minister should come to the spot.

Who is Ram Briksh Yadav?

  • Ram Briksh Yadav is a disciple of Baba Jai Guru Dev.
  • Yadav came to light when he claimed for the property of Baba Jai Guru Dev after his death.
  • He reached Mathura on March 15, 2014 along with 200 people.
  • He sought the permission from district administration to stay there for two days.
  • Yadav, later occupied the 270 acres of land at Jawaharbagh locality.
  • Around 10 criminal cases are registered against Yadav since March 2014 in Mathua.
  • It is also being reported that around 5,000 men worked for him.
